Transaction 3fafc8678acf052da4bff03a25bdeba43a0694a466f570c71eda15f93d208106

9 Input
2 Outputs
  • 3fafc8678acf052da4bff03a25bdeba43a0694a466f570c71eda15f93d208106:0
  • value  36476939
    address  3HEXpnSCAGdo7hkWncFPssi1MjzDacEDcL
  • 3fafc8678acf052da4bff03a25bdeba43a0694a466f570c71eda15f93d208106:1
  • value  1778098
    address  334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L